Product Description

What if the best project manager didn’t exist? In this provocative and future-facing manifesto, Peter Taylor, the original Lazy Project Manager, asks the uncomfortable questions about the impact on his profession from the inexorable rise of artificial intelligence. Traditional project management has created a substantial legacy, but what if project managers aren’t evolving but evaporating?What if success no longer needs a command-and-control human hero at the helm?Thanks to the power of AI, the next generation of project delivery won’t be managed, it will be orchestrated, seamlessly, silently, invisibly.It just might be the end of project management as we know it and the beginning of something radically smarter - but humans will still be very much involved, and this book explains how.It defines the ‘Invisible Project Manager’ future where AI systems manage workflows, timelines, and resources, while the ‘human-in-the-loop’ will be a vastly different skillset moving from the managers of activities to guardians of outcome.Accelerated change to the project management profession is arriving soon, and at speed. This book is an essential and thought-provoking guide to evolution for forward-looking leaders, digital transformation strategists, and change agents who are planning for the long game.Are you ready to disappear?
